What type of data is qualitative data?

Explanation:
Qualitative data refers to non-numerical information that is often descriptive and subjective. It is primarily focused on understanding characteristics, qualities, and themes rather than measurable quantities. Choosing data derived from observing student work exemplifies qualitative data because it involves capturing insights about students’ thought processes, behaviors, and learning experiences. This kind of data helps educators understand how students approach tasks, their engagement levels, and the strategies they employ, providing rich information that can inform instructional practices and support individualized learning. The other options focus on numerical or statistical aspects, which are characteristic of quantitative data. Numerical data from assessments and percentage scores from tests provide measurable outcomes that can be analyzed quantitatively, while statistical data on student performance summarizes and represents data points in a numerical format. Each of these options emphasizes a different dimension of student performance that does not align with the qualitative nature of observational data.
